  • Episode 143: Winter readiness, get your house in order
    Feb 6 2026

    While it's important to have stockpiles full, equipment repaired and ready, and staff training and assignments set, it's important to have your home weather ready as well. After all, when you're out there battling the weather, there's peace of mind knowing that your own home and family are safe and sound. On this episode we're Talkin' Winter Ops with Jake Sorber, Research Project Scientist with the Insurance Institute for Business and Home Safety. Jake highlights the work of the Insurance Institute for Business & Home Safety (IBHS) in helping homeowners prepare for winter weather and take proactive steps to reduce risks and avoid costly repairs.

    For additional ways to protect your home from harsh winter conditions, you can find a full checklist at ibhs.org/winter-ready/ to help you get started.

  • Episode 141: Maintenance-If you think it's not important, just stop doing it
    Jan 16 2026

    From that moment the very first engineering project was completed the age of maintenance began. While the initial delivery of the public work carries a lot of fanfare nothing is more important than keeping it functional and in service. Maintenance organizations have been intrusted to manage every aspect of those assets since before Asset Management was a thing. From mowing and debris pickup to restoring mobility after the blizzard of flood, it's all important. George Conner, Deputy Director of Maintenance and Operations at the Alabama DOT and Chair of AASHTOs Maintenance Committee says if you don't think it's important just stop doing it and see how important it is to the users.

    George has a huge passion for maintenance and on this episode he shares his insights and perspective on maintenance and the folks that keep the highway network clean, repaired and functional 24/7/365.
